About The Position

Responsible for the supervision, organization and coordination of daily operation of acute care and post-acute care phlebotomy services, under the direction of the Laboratory Manager. Assists in selecting, training, evaluation, and motivation of team members. Models the Stormont Vail Tenets of compassion, connection, patient safety and privacy, and improving the health of our community. Works closely with other laboratory personnel, Patient Care Services staff, healthcare providers, and patients to obtain high quality specimens.

Responsibilities

  • Responsible for performing the essential functions of a phlebotomist.
  • Provides day-to-day supervision of phlebotomy team.
  • In conjunction with senior leadership, interviews and recommends applicants for hire.
  • Conducts annual performance appraisals and oversees competency assessments of team members.
  • Interprets and implements departmental and organizational policies and keeps team members advised in advance of changes.
  • Prepares work schedule.
  • Adjusts daily schedule and team member work assignments and coordinates cross training as required for efficient utilization of personnel.
  • Monitors key indicators and quality systems for their section.
  • Reports the status of the section to laboratory leadership.
  • Identifies problems and deficiencies with supplies, staffing or equipment.
  • Reports on feelings and attitudes of the team.
  • Looks for opportunities to improve operations.
  • Develops a strong team atmosphere to foster mutual respect and trust.
  • Deals appropriately and proactively with team member conflict.
  • Communicates effectively with staff and physicians.
  • Maintains appropriate standards for behavior and attendance, providing appropriate corrective action per policy.
  • Ensures effective orientation of new staff.
  • Coaches and teaches staff, consistently provides leadership and clinical expertise.
  • Train new employees through encouragement, positive reinforcement and constructive criticism.
  • Assists in meeting standards set forth by CLIA, Joint Commission, CAP, AABB and other regulatory and governing bodies.
  • Supports the Laboratory’s Quality Improvement efforts by initiating action to prevent the occurrence of non-conformance related to specimen collection and customer service.
  • Reviews incidents and complaints and takes action in timely fashion.
  • Assists in development and maintenance of department policies, procedure manuals, work standards and goal setting.
  • Builds a safety culture by following best practices for laboratory and patient safety.
  • Ensures compliance of team members with safety procedures in laboratory and hospital policies.
  • Supervises outreach (client) laboratory specimen collections.
  • Ensures that scheduled specimen collection are completed in a timely and efficient manner.
  • Responds appropriately to requests by clients for STAT collection services.
  • Provides oversight of laboratory team members’ use of the organization’s vehicles.
